Greater Towson Committee Hires New Executive Director

The nonprofit organization focuses on promoting development and revitalization efforts in Towson.

Katie Pinheiro was recently hired at the executive director for the Greater Towson Commitee.

In her new role, Pinheiro will represent the interests of the nonprofit, which promotes development and revitalization in Towson, to local businesses, government leaders and the community, according to a news release.

"Katie is a tremendous addition to the Greater Towson Committee. Her professional background, local roots and knowledge, and dedication to the improvement of Towson will contribute to the success of GTC’s efforts," said Jim Railey, president of the group, in the statement. "We welcome her enthusiasm and drive to the team."

Before joining the nonprofit, Pinheiro, a Towson native, worked as a mortage professional for United Equity.

The Greater Towson Commitee is a largely volunteer-run organization consisting of local business professionals.
